Loose or Shifting Teeth



If you notice your teeth ending up being loosened or moving, it's critical to consult an oral surgeon promptly. This could be an indication of a serious oral concern that calls for timely attention. Here are some reasons that loose or moving teeth shouldn't be neglected:

- Trauma or injury: Teeth can come to be loosened as a result of a strike to the mouth or face. A dental specialist can analyze the damages and give appropriate therapy.

- Gum condition: Advanced periodontal disease can create the supporting frameworks of the teeth to compromise, causing tooth flexibility. A dental surgeon can examine the level of the illness and recommend treatment choices.

- Dental cavity: Extreme decay can weaken the integrity of the tooth, causing it to end up being loose. An oral specialist can establish the best course of action.

- Bite troubles: Misaligned teeth or an incorrect bite can trigger teeth to change or end up being loose. An oral specialist can resolve these issues and prevent more damage.

- Bone loss: Sometimes, bone loss in the jaw can trigger teeth to become loose. An oral specialist can evaluate the scenario and provide appropriate therapy to recover security.

Clicking or Standing Out Jaw Joint



Do you experience a clicking or popping experience in your jaw joint? This could be an indication that you need to speak with a dental cosmetic surgeon instantly.

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, likewise referred to as the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can indicate a trouble with the joint's positioning or feature. It may be caused by conditions such as TMJ disorder, arthritis, or a displaced disc in the joint.
